Conclusions:
The substance sowed no effect on activated sludge up to a test concentration of 1000 mg/L.
Executive summary:

The substance was tested for bacteria toxicity by a respiration inhibition test with not adapted activated sludge according to OECD guideline 209. Concentrations used were 100 - 180 - 320 - 580 - 1000 [mg/l]. As reference substance copper(II)sulfate pentahydrate was used. In none of the tested concentrations between 100 and 1000 mg/L arespiration inhibition could be observed,
